Our friend, Michael Case, a conductor for Amtrak, was senselessly shot on May 16th while assisting passengers on/off the train in nearby Naperville.  The offender, an elderly man, was subdued by other passengers until police arrived and he was then taken into custody.   

At first, alert and talking, Michael was taken to Edward Hospital.  The gunshot initially reported as “non life threatening” proved more complex upon further evaluation and he underwent an extensive 9 ½ hr  surgery; he is now in the ICU still listed in critical condition.  His wife Sara, along with their children, his parents, siblings and his many, many friends have all been keeping vigil at the hospital or via phone since the incident- this act of violence has rocked many lives. 

Michael proudly served in the Navy for 4yrs as a Submariner.  He is a genuinely wonderful guy, a great dad, loving husband and an awesome friend to so, so many.  He loved his job and his passengers enjoyed each and every ride with him between Kansas City and Chicago, his usual route.
